Position Summary

The Renewal Brokerage Assistant supports the brokerage team by managing policy renewals, maintaining client records, coordinating communications with carriers and clients, and ensuring a smooth renewal process. This role is critical in delivering exceptional customer service, maintaining compliance, and supporting revenue retention through efficient renewal management.

Key Responsibilities

  • Track and manage upcoming policy renewals to ensure timely processing.
  • Prepare renewal applications, proposals, and supporting documentation.
  • Communicate with insurance carriers to obtain renewal quotes, endorsements, and policy information.
  • Review renewal terms and identify discrepancies or missing information.
  • Coordinate with brokers, account managers, and clients throughout the renewal cycle.
  • Maintain accurate client records and documentation within agency management systems.
  • Process policy changes, endorsements, certificates, and other administrative requests.
  • Assist with invoicing, premium financing documentation, and payment follow-up as needed.
  • Ensure compliance with company procedures, carrier guidelines, and regulatory requirements.
  • Respond promptly to client inquiries and provide outstanding customer service.
  • Generate reports and track renewal metrics to support business objectives.
